MNRE Incentives Restricted to Rooftop Solar Systems Connected to the Grid

The Ministry of New and Renewable Energy (MNRE) has issued amendments to the guidelines for the Phase II of the rooftop solar program. In the new guidelines, the Ministry has said that the implementing agency should assign a minimum of 10% of the total allocated quantity to the lowest bidder. If the vendor does not execute the allocated quantity, the bank guarantee will be encashed, and the vendor blacklisted for five years.
